1. PURPOSE

The purpose of this procedure is to map-out the process of approvals and documentation
required to issue Construction Variation Order (CVO) to Contractors due to Change Requests
initiated by the Employer, Hill (as the Project Management Consultant), the Supervision
Consultant, or Contractor in connection with the design and construction and/or installation
works on the IFRANE PALACE Project.

2. SCOPE

This procedure applies to all construction contracts initiated by the Employer for construction
and/or installation works on the IFRANE PALACE Project.

This procedure applies to all construction contracts where the Contractors scope of works
requires changing, including drawing changes, specification changes and changes to the
method and sequence of working. It shall also apply to the expenditure of Provisional Sums.
Changes as a result of Confirmation of Verbal Instructions (CVIs) and Requests for Information
(RFIs) having a time and/or cost impact shall be subject to Employers Approval via this
procedure.

The person in Hill or the other company responsible for ensuring the procedure
OWNER
is implemented, maintained and controlled

PARTICIPANT The person in Hill or another company who is or may be involved in


implementation of the procedure

INITIATOR / The person in Hill or the other company who starts the process
ORIGINATOR
APPROVER The person holding final authority for signature for approval of the product of
the process
SIGNATORY A person who signs for approval on behalf of the Participants Organization

INFORMED A person who receives a copy of the information and is not otherwise involved
in the process. All the above parties are deemed to be informed.

4. RESPONSIBILITIES

Employers The Employers Representative shall be responsible for coordinating


Representative the approval of variation orders within the Employers organization.
The Employer shall be responsible for making the final decision for
approval and issue of variation orders.

Hill Project Manager Hill Project Manager shall monitor this procedure to ensure that it is
properly implemented.

Hill Project Manager shall be responsible for coordinating the


approval of variation orders. Any proposed changes to a Contractors
scope of work shall be subject to the approval of the Employers
Representative.

Hill Hill Contracts Manager has functional responsibility for all contract
Contracts variation administration.
Manager
Hill Contracts Manager shall make recommendation to Hill Project
Director on the merit of a variation.

Hill Design Manager Hill Design Manager shall be responsible for notifying the Contracts
Manager and Project Director of any changes made to the original
design during the construction stage.

Hill Project Hill Project Controls Manager shall be responsible for reviewing and
Controls Manager advising the Hill Contracts Manager and Project Director on all
matters associated with the time / schedule elements of instructions
and changes.

Cost Consultant The Cost Consultant shall advise the Project Management
Consultants Contracts Manager on all matters associated with the
cost of instructions and changes.

Supervision The Supervision Consultant shall be responsible for review of cost &
Consultant time proposal of contractors and coordinating the approval of
variation orders.
The Supervision Consultant shall be empowered to issue authorized
Site Works Instruction and approved VOs to a Contractors scope of
work.

5. INSTRUCTIONS
Action by

GENERAL

All communication between PMC, Supervision Consultant and the


Contractor relevant to this procedure, shall follow the established
Project Communication Plan and the approved Project
Management Plan (PMP).

5.1 EMPLOYER DRIVEN VARIATIONS PROCEDURE (DURING


CONSTRUCTION)

The process below is to be used for variations initiated by the


Employer which results into a change of scope to the contractor.

All contractual documents sent out by Hill Project Team shall be


sent through Hill Project Manager and Document Controller.

5.2 CONTRACTORS' VARIATIONS PROCEDURE BY SWI

The process below is referred to as the Site Work Instruction (SWI)


Method and is to be used for Site Works Instruction of items which
are necessary to avoid abortive works.

5.3 CONTRACTORS' REQUEST FOR VARIATION PROCEDURE

When FIDIC rules applies, Contractor's Variations request arises if an


instruction from the Supervision Consultant Engineer constitutes a
Variation as per Clause 3.3 of the Conditions of Contract for
Construction, FIDIC 1999.
All Variations must be approved by the Employer, prior to
commencement of Work. Unless otherwise agreed with the
Employer,
for all Variations please refer to Clause 13 of the Conditions of
Contract for Construction, FIDIC 1999.
